			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h2>Create Unseen Effects With Embossing</h2>
<p><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/embossedenvelope.jpg"><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-794" title="embossed envelope"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/embossedenvelope.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="226" /></a><br />
The outcome of the embossed effect is unique and elegant. It can be used to add extra graphic pizzazz to your <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/business-sets/pet-business-id-package.php">stationery</a>, <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/marketing-channels/annual-report-cover-design.php">reports</a>, or booklets. But it is not always used for ornamental purposes. The engraved effects of embossing also have a very practical use for the vision impaired. Braille embossers provide a means for blind people to read. They do this by using their fingers where they feel the surface to read it. For blind and sighted people this unique form of embossed paper treatment has been practiced for centuries. Let’s examine the a few types of embossing you can experiment with.</p>
<h3>Dry Embossing</h3>
<p><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/Untitled-3.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-795" title="Dry Embossed"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/Untitled-3.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="300" /></a><br />
Here you use a stylus combined with a tracing technique to form a pattern on paper. The pattern can be raised or depressed depending on which side of the paper is up.</p>
<h2>The Basics of Heat Embossing</h2>
<p>This embossing technique is commonly used in scrapbook building. To perform heat embossing you will need the following items:</p>
<p>* These Items can be found at your local arts and Craft Supply stores<br />
* Stamp stamping for imagery or alpha characters<br />
* A Heat gun<br />
* Embossing Powder<br />
* Embossing ink pad</p>
<h2>Embossed Printing General</h2>
<p>Embossing is most often practiced for decorative purposes. Its affects are timeless, elegant, memorable, and lasting. It is often produced on larger solid areas and is known for its subtle broad features. Embossing forces (stresses) a material to create raised or depressed bumps. With embossed printing it is a process where areas of paper are patterned by forcing paper fibers to move from pressure treatments. It is inherently difficult process when the embossed impression contains fine line detail.</p>
<p>Embossed printing will add elegance to fine patterns you want to tastefully integrate into your corporate image. By making an image raised or depressed you are adding an extra dimensions to your imagery. The effect will change the nature of the material you present to your viewers. By giving it a quaint look your image is enhanced by a blank impression onto paper. It can include print imagery or blank. An image without ink is known as blind embossing. A blank impression onto paper is made used as a unique graphic affect of a reading instrument for blind people (Braille).</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h2>How Does Raised Printing Work?</h2>
<p><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/text-tool-apr2007_r1_c8_f2.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-783" title="text-tool-apr2007_r1_c8_f2"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/text-tool-apr2007_r1_c8_f2.jpg" alt="" width="31" height="30" /></a> You can print raised lettering on a card, stationery, handouts or any printed item where you feel a second look is in order. Raised printing is also known as thermography. This applies especially to raised print business cards, after-all your <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/tag/business-card-samples">business card</a> can be a very busy printed item. Arguably it is one of the most traveled marketing instruments in your arsenal.<br />
<span id="more-773"></span></p>
<h3>Step One Printing</h3>
<p>This process is the same as traditional <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/business-card-design-tips/coatings-and-the-printing-process.php">commercial printing</a> in the beginning phase. The sheet of paper travels thorough a printing press and is printed with an image. The image comes from a plate that is developed similarly to photography. The surface of the plate is flat and each time it rotates 360 degrees it obtains a fresh supply of ink water. The ink adheres to the developed areas of the plate and the water keeps the non developed areas clean.</p>
<p><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image001.jpg"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-774" title="Step One- Commercial Printing"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image001.jpg" alt="Commercial Printing" width="500" height="226" /></a></p>
<p>So the order it happens is like this; Plate Cylinder &gt; blanket &gt; paper.</p>
<h3>Step Two Vacuum Pick-up Pad to Powder Unit</h3>
<p>A newer feature with today&#8217;s raised printing systems it trackless picks up heads. This means that <strong>nothing touches the freshly printed sheet</strong>. It virtually eliminates <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/printing-bloopers/ink-piling.php">ink</a> and powder tracking on the printed piece. Below we can see the sheets of paper leaving the printing press and moving into the first steps of thermography,  powdering.<br />
<a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image002.gif"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-779" title="Step Two Vacuum Pick-up Pad to Powder Unit"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image002.gif" alt="Vacuum Pick-up Pad to Powder Unit" width="478" height="356" /></a><br />
The powder unit holds the powder that is sprinkled on the wet ink.</p>
<div id="attachment_776" class="wp-caption alignnone" style="width: 510px"><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image003.jpg"><img class="size-full wp-image-776" title="Receives a frosting of powder"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image003.jpg" alt="" width="500" height="373"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">Frosting of powder</p></div>
<p>As the sheet of paper travels through the powder unit is receives a frosting of powder. This fine powder sticks to the wet ink on the paper.<br />
<a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image004.jpg"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-777" title="image004"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image004.jpg" alt="" width="474" height="350" /></a></p>
<h3>Step 3- The Heat Tunnel</h3>
<p>Once the paper exits the powder unit, it moves into the heat tunnel. The heat tunnel is inferred light that causes a reaction between the powder and ink, causing these areas to swell (raise)</p>
<h3>Step 4- The Delivery</h3>
<p><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image005.jpg"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-778" title="Step 3- The Heat Tunnel"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/image005.jpg" alt="The Heat Tunnel" width="500" height="373" /></a><br />
Finally the sheet is ejected from the heat tunnel and safely lands in the delivery tray.</p>
<p>At the end of this process you will end up with a crisply printed raising printed result. There are limits with raised printing because of the way it is done. For example fine lines or fine line tints are often missed or distorted. When the powder and ink are baked is when most of the distortion takes place. Although you can attempt to print <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/litho-knowledge-base/advertise.php">tints</a> (screen @ 133 LPI or better) the result will be a somewhat clogged looking appearance. The same way fine lines (.2 px. or less) will not print as intended. It is sometimes recommended to print in both flat and raised inks together so that all design elements are produced to give the desired result.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>One of the most common uses for embossed printing in printmaking is logos. When you emboss logos you are raising areas of a paper above the level of the paper’s natural state. During the actual production of embossed printing several tons of pressure is used. The embossing die and the embossed paper become united in a printing press and the impression of the brass or magnesium plate is left on the surface of the paper.</p>
<p><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/brass_mag_dies_pic_r4_c2.gif"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-800" title="brass_mag_dies_pic_r4_c2"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/brass_mag_dies_pic_r4_c2.gif" alt="" width="335" height="51" /></a></p>
<p>Often (not always) colour inks, spot color printing and <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/about-color/printed-with-varnish.php">varnishing </a>are combined. When inks are not included in embossed printing it is known as blind embossed. This form of embossed engraving is also used to produce Brail, which is how the vision impaired people read. When you get your printing Blind embossed in business it is recognized as <strong>luxurious and extravagant</strong>.</p>
<p><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/special_prepare.gif"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-801" title="special_prepare"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/special_prepare.gif" alt="" width="280" height="141" /></a>To begin the embossed print process you need a concept. Once you have your graphic elements visualized they need to be illustrated in line art form. Next you will need to make a die for embossing. The least expensive way to produce the embossing die is to use magnesium based dies. They can be created photo-mechanically or digitally. This method of embossing paper may not be what you are looking for. Perhaps you want multi levels to your embossing die. In this case you need to define the depth of layers. A good example of embossed printing can be found here. This will help you <strong>understand </strong>what is involved in making a plate by using layers.</p>
<p>Making the communication method from an embossed printing buyer to the vendor of choice clarity.  Logos should be delivered clearly and concisely if perfection is the goal. Embossed Printing involves changing the shape of embossed paper to create multi-levels of fine imagery with paper. To transfer your desired effect on paper precisely, a simplification and outlines of the effect are required. Executed properly a beautiful three dimensional design on elegant paper will be sure to dazzle the most cynical design critics.</p>
<p>This old school, fine line, elegant method of printmaking is not cheap. The embossing die that is needed can also have tremendous impact on the price of embossed printing. A mag (magnesium) die, Brass Cup die, Brass Sculptured die are all priced much differently. I have listed them in order of production costs, the least expensive being a magnesium die. The basic rule of thumb is, this style of print- making is double the price of conventional printing using inks, at least.</p>
<p>The process of embossing is a lot like foil stamping, in fact the embossing machines that perform custom embossing also produce foil stamping. The added part to the process is the transfer of foil, which is applied from a roll that feeds into the embossing press as required. It can also bee combined with embossing ink, spot colors, and CMYK colors.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h2>A Definition of Aqueous Coating</h2>
<p><div id="attachment_252" class="wp-caption alignnone" style="width: 451px"><a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2007/09/46_plane_gif.jpg"><img class="size-full wp-image-252  " title="Press Coatings Combined in the Spray" src="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/wp-content/uploads/2007/09/46_plane_gif.jpg" alt="" width="441" height="575"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">Look at the Crop Duster&#39;s Spray Through Press Coatings</p></div><br />
This coating will be similar to <a href="http://galearning.com/weprintcolor/about-color/printed-with-varnish.php">varnish</a> on both coated and uncoated papers but provides better protection over time. It is a low-pollution coating made under strict environmental-protective standards. It is a totally a water based coating which is applied in the same manner as ink on press. The coating can have an impact on its performance over time by withstanding wear and tear, scuffing and resistance to water. It can be applied in glossy, Matte or Satin finish to diffuse refection for better readability. When this protective coating is used it will typically cover the entire press sheet, but can also be set up to print the same as spot varnish (A custom graphic shape such as a logo)</p>

<h2>An Explanation of Aqueous Coating</h2>
<p><img src="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/images/aq.jpg" alt="Explanation of Aqueous Coating" width="300" height="257" align="left" /><a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/paper-and-ink/aq-fm-line-screen.php">Aqueous coating</a> is produced in one pass through the press which saves you the cost of an additional press run. A coating that also offers &#8220;spot&#8221; coating options where specific graphic areas are coated only. The coating is clear but should not yellow over time as varnish does. This coating can be printed on both Color Sides easily. This is a covering that can be applied on two sides for any type of paper, higher gloss materials present a greater challenge. Aqueous coating can have impact on its print performance over time.</p>

<h3><strong>Paper Based Business Card Printing Options <img src="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/images/business-card-images/WePrintColor-com-People-561.gif" alt="" width="175" height="202" align="right" /></strong></h3>
<p><em>The printing of your business card can be done a few different ways:</em></p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Buy Perforated (tear out) sheets</strong> from your local office supply outlet and print them on your own printer. This can be used for a presentation that you have forgotten to <strong>get professional business cards</strong> for. Although this method is easy and cheap I do not recommend it as these cards will not stand up to wear and tear or moisture contact.<strong> Warning :</strong> Inkjet printing smears and runs if exposed to moisture &#8211; this does not leave a positive impression with your prospect after sitting in their sweaty pocket for a few minutes</li>
<li><strong>Digital-</strong> this means that your card is printed on some sort of digital printing machine, usually toner based. If you consider this option it is important to understand that your <strong>print quality will not compare</strong> with true <a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/tag/lithography">print and litho</a>, especially when you factor in technologies such as <a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/paper-and-ink/cmyk-rgb-pantone.php">FM line screen and Aqueous Coatings</a>. The reason one might consider this option is due to time constraints, but the truth is this style of card will not stand up against lithography.</li>
<li><strong>True Print and Litho-</strong> You may want to choose the design options that support a greater array of color that offset print and litho delivers. There are 2 basic colors styles of sheet fed offset printing, spot color and <a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/paper-and-ink/cmyk-rgb-pantone.php#113">CMYK color</a>. <a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/paper-and-ink/cmyk-rgb-pantone.php#111">Spot Color</a> or CMYK printing is where a <a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/paper-and-ink/paper-ink-summary.php">printing press</a> is used to produce your business card. The ink is actually <a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/paper-and-ink/paper-ink-together.php">absorbed into the paper </a>a certain degree. The amount of absorbency depends on whether you are using a matt or glossy finish. In either case the ink is absorbed into the material which creates a better bond between ink and paper. You may also opt in on a <a href="http://www.galearning.com/weprintcolor/paper-and-ink/cmyk-rgb-pantone.php">protective coating</a> which will further enhance the longevity and colors of your card. Professional printing is the best way to produce your business cards, although some digital gurus may argue that point, I gladly invite any comments on this blog.</li>
</ul>
